Biography
Prof/Dr Grant Russell completed his fellowship of Certified Management Accounts (CMA). Currently he retired as a Distinguished Professor Emeritus from the University of Waterloo, Finance. He is awarded as Distinguished Teaching Award, University of Waterloo, 2000 and Elected "Fellow" of the Society of Management Accountants of Canada. Board of Directors, CMA of Canada, Periodically from 1978 - 2002. Chair, Audit Committee, Society of Management Accountants of Canada, ending 2002.
Research Interest
Accounting, Accounting and Financial Management, Building and validating financial and non financial performance measures for manufacturing operations, Accounting for the environment, the determination of appropriate costing models in Design to Cost environments, and ethical practices within management accounting.
